Postcode BB5 2ER is located in an urban city, within the Barnfield ward of Hyndburn in the North West region, and forms part of the Accrington South East area. It has very high deprivation and very high crime levels, with around 356.8 crimes per 1,000 residents per year, roughly 3.3× the North West average of 109 per 1,000. The average income per household in Accrington South East is £43,179 per year. The nearest station is Accrington, about 0.2 miles away. There are 13 primary and 3 secondary schools in the area.

Accrington South East has a very high level of deprivation, ranked at position 241 out of 32,844 areas in the United Kingdom, placing it within the top 1% most deprived areas in England.

Based on 28 recent sales, the median property price is £179,500 (about £148 per square foot) in Barnfield area, with individual transactions ranging from £39,999 up to £330,000.

Is BB5 2ER (Accrington South East) safe?

The area around BB5 2ER records about 357 crimes per 1,000 residents per year, which is a very high crime rate for England: it scores 10 out of 10 on the Area360 crime scale, where 10 is the highest crime level. Across North West as a whole the rate is about 109 per 1,000. The most common offences locally are violence and sexual offences, anti-social behaviour and criminal damage and arson.
